WebBuckets are a mainstay tool for tile work. Use them to gather and transport your tools, collect debris from demo, mix thinset and grout, and hold water for cleanup. Plastic buckets are light, cheap, and easy to clean. The 5-gal. size is great for mixing big batches and cleanup, while the 1/2-gal. size is ideal for mixing small quantities of ...
